Understanding DPI Settings

  • πŸ’‘ The video explains DPI (Dots Per Inch) settings on the OPPO Find X9 Pro, focusing on how it affects UI element size.
  • 🎯 It clarifies that DPI is related to display scaling, not mouse sensitivity.

Enabling Developer Options

  • πŸ”‘ To access advanced display settings, you first need to enable Developer Options.
  • βš™οΈ Navigate to Settings β†’ About Device, then repeatedly tap the Build number, Version number, or Software version until Developer Options are unlocked.

Adjusting Smallest Width (DPI)

  • πŸ› οΈ Once Developer Options are enabled, go to Settings β†’ System & Update β†’ Developer Options.
  • πŸ“ Scroll down to the 'Drawing' section and find the Smallest Width setting.
  • πŸ“ˆ The default DPI is typically 360, but this value can be adjusted to make UI elements larger or smaller.
  • ⚠️ Be cautious when changing this value, as extreme settings can make the interface difficult to use.

Modifying Display and Font Size

  • πŸ“± For simpler adjustments, go to Settings β†’ Display & Brightness.
  • πŸ–ΌοΈ Here you can change the Display Size between Large, Standard, and Small options.
  • βœ’οΈ You can also adjust the Font Size independently.
  • βœ… These settings offer an alternative way to customize the on-screen display for better readability or to fit more content.
